A construction contract is a legally binding agreement detailing project specifics, roles, responsibilities, costs, and timelines. It establishes the terms under which construction work will be performed, offering legal protection and a framework for resolving disagreements.
Critical elements include scope of work, payment schedules, change order procedures, insurance requirements, and dispute resolution mechanisms. Proper drafting and review ensure these terms align with client goals and applicable law.

A typical construction contract includes the scope of work, payment terms, project schedules, and responsibilities of each party. It also covers change orders, warranties, insurance, and dispute resolution clauses to safeguard all involved parties. Having a clear and detailed contract helps prevent misunderstandings and provides a legal basis for resolving any disagreements that may arise during construction.
You should have a construction contract reviewed before signing any documents or commencing work. Early review ensures that terms are fair, lawful, and aligned with your project goals. Professional review can identify potential risks and ambiguities, allowing you to address them proactively and avoid costly disputes later.
Yes, construction contracts can be modified through change orders or written amendments agreed upon by all parties. Modifications should always be documented formally to keep the contract enforceable. Clear procedures for changes help manage expectations and maintain project continuity without legal complications.
If a party breaches the contract, the non-breaching party may seek remedies such as damages, contract termination, or specific performance depending on the terms agreed upon. Having precise contract terms and dispute resolution clauses can facilitate faster and more effective resolution of breaches.
